    MACL announces new partners of debut Air Service World Congress

    MACL announces five new partners of the Air Service World Congress 2024

    Maldives Airports Company Limited (MACL) on Sunday, July 07, announced five new partners from the travel industry for the upcoming Air Service World Congress (ASWC) 2024.

    The new partners are Avia Maldives, Maagiri Hotel, Skytours Maldives, Villa Travels, and Maldives Flight Support.

    Event Partners

    • Travel Industry Partners: Avia Maldives, Maagiri Hotel, Skytours Maldives, Villa Travels, Maldives Flight Support
    • Resort Partners: Sheraton, Crossroads SAii Lagoon
    • Venue Partner: Kurumba Maldives
    • Digital Partner: Dhiraagu
    • Seaplane Partner: TMA
    • Airline Partner: Emirates
    • Aviation Partner: Maldivian
    • Media Partners: Island Chief, Orca Media, Hotelier Maldives, The Arrival, Travelusion Media

    Endorsement Partners

    • Ministry of Tourism
    • Ministry of Transport and Civil Aviation
    • Maldives Association of Tourism Industry (MATI)
    • Maldives Association of Travel Agents and Tour Operators (MATATO)

    The Air Service World Congress 2024 is the first aviation route development event in the Maldives, bringing together international delegates for in-person discussions about the future of aviation.

    The event is expected to attract more than 150 delegates from various regions of the world, which would include airport and route development executives, airline executives, airline networking planners, aviation suppliers, and representatives from aviation and tourism bodies.

    The debut edition of AWSC is scheduled from July 09 to 11, 2024 at Kurumba Maldives.
